The timing <strong>of</strong> the administration <strong>of</strong> ethanol was an important factor. When ethanol<br />

was given 3 h after alprazolam, only minimal effects were found (116). When ethanol<br />

was given only 45 min after alprazolam, however, it had additive effects on most <strong>of</strong> the<br />

end points measured (110). Similarly, combining ethanol with diazepam at the same<br />

time led to enhanced impairment <strong>of</strong> reaction time (112), whereas giving the ethanol 3 h<br />

after diazepam did not (116).<br />
